  1. David Paul Smith

    David Smith, PC, QC, BA, LL.B (born May 16 1941) is a Canadian lawyer and politician. Smith was an alderman on Toronto City Council in the 1970s. He served a period as deputy mayor and president of city council. He ran for Mayor of Toronto in 1978, but was defeated by John Sewell in a three-way split. Smith became a backroom lobbyist for developers and was instrumental in helping Art Eggleton defeat Sewell in 1980.

  2. David A. Smith

    David Alan Smith (born 1957 in Camp Lejeune, North Carolina) is an American computer scientist and entrepreneur who has focused on interactive 3D and using 3D as a basis for new user environments and entertainment for over twenty years. In 1987, Smith created "The Colony," the very first 3D interactive game and precursor to today's first-person shooters.

  4. David Smith

    David Smith (born September 25, 1963) is a Canadian politician. A former member of the Canadian House of Commons, Smith served as a city councillor in Maniwaki, Quebec until 2004. At this point, he ran in the Canadian federal election, 2004 for the Liberal Party of Canada in the riding of Pontiac where he won. He is a former business manager and public servant.   5. David James Elliott

    David James Elliott (born David William Smith on September 21, 1960 in Milton, Ontario, Canada) is a Canadian-born actor who was the star of the series "JAG" from 1995 to 2005, playing lead character Harmon Rabb Jr.. During his teenage years he was part of a band, quitting Milton District High School in his final year to pursue his dream of becoming a rock star. At 19 however he realized this wouldn't happen and returned to finish high school.

  40. Davey Boy Smith

    David Boy ("Davey Boy") Smith (November 28, 1962 - May 18, 2002) was a British professional wrestler. Born in Golborne, Warrington (now in the Borough of Wigan), Smith is best known for his appearances in the United States of America with the World Wrestling Federation under his own name and under the ring name The British Bulldog. Smith's middle name really was "Boy".
